Born on October 5, 1934, in Modugno, Bari, Italy, Rocco was the beloved son of Giuseppe Camasta and Anna Cramarossa. His mother, Anna, passed away at a young age, and his father later remarried Maria Saliani. Rocco grew up alongside his four brothers, Francesco, Stefano, Vincenzo and Tommaso, and his sister, Anna.
He immigrated to Toronto, Canada, in November 1953 at just 19 years old, leaving his hometown in search of a better life and greater opportunities. Like so many Italian immigrants of his generation, he came to Canada with the hope of finding a place where the streets were said to be paved with gold. He was welcomed by his brother Francesco and began building the life and family that would become his greatest legacy.
Rocco is lovingly remembered by his brother Vincenzo and sister Anna, and was predeceased by his brothers Francesco, Stefano and Tommaso.
In the summer of 1956, Rocco married his beloved wife, Pasquina, in Toronto. Together, they built a loving family and were blessed with two sons, Giuseppe (Nancy) and Robert (Maria), four grandchildren, Patricia (Ian), Laura, Christina and Jonathan, and three great-grandchildren, Cole, Henry and Louie.
Rocco lived a fulfilling life rooted in family, hard work, travel and the simple things he enjoyed. He remained deeply connected to his Italian roots, returning to Italy every few years to visit his hometown and reconnect with family and friends. He also looked forward to his annual month-long winter vacation in Acapulco, enjoyed tending to his garden, and was always proud of his ability to fix, build and work with his hands.
A hardworking and dedicated man, Rocco worked two jobs for many years — at a paper factory in the mornings and as a caretaker in the evenings for the Toronto District School Board. His determination and strong work ethic became an important part of the family values he passed down through the generations.
